Windows processes are specific tasks that are carried out when you launch an .exe file. A single application can run dozens or even hundreds of processes simultaneously. So, if they aren’t working as they should – for example because they get stuck or don’t complete fast enough – this impacts your resources and, in turn, your network’s performance.
Windows process monitoring is the continuous evaluation of various parameters of a Windows process to assess how well it performs its functions and whether it is working at all. For example, you can track the number of system resources used by a process, whether a process is active, and more.
Windows process monitoring allows you to identify bottlenecks in the program's operation, detect malfunctions in advance before they lead to program failures, find the root causes of issues, and eliminate them.

You could use Microsoft’s sysinternals. But many of those utilities only work if you already know what you’re looking for. And even those that enable you to continuously log data, like Task Manager and Process Explorer, don’t have built-in alert capabilities or other automations.
A good Windows process monitor, on the other hand, can both continuously log data and alert you if something doesn’t look quite right. Plus, it brings all your data together in one place, so you always know what’s going on at a glance, which saves time, avoidable disruption, and headaches.
PRTG monitors Windows processes using Windows Management Instrumentation or Windows performance counters. Each sensor monitors a particular metric, such as CPU usage or thread activity, which you specify when setting it up. PRTG supports unlimited hardware, software, and virtual devices. That said, the Windows process sensor has a high performance impact, so we recommend running not more than 200 instances of it on a single probe.
In PRTG, “sensors” are the basic monitoring elements. One sensor usually monitors one measured value in your network, for example the traffic of a switch port, the CPU load of a server, or the free space on a disk drive. On average, you need about 5-10 sensors per device or one sensor per switch port.
